How Can Beginner Welders Choose Their Certification Path?

Beginner welders can choose their certification path by considering their career goals, understanding the different types of certifications available, and selecting the appropriate training programs that align with industry standards.

Career goals: Beginners should identify their specific interests within welding, such as structural, pipe, or automotive welding. According to the American Welding Society (AWS), different sectors may require distinct certifications.

Types of certifications:
– AWS Certification: The AWS offers various certifications based on skill levels and techniques. These include Certified Welder (CW) and Certified Welding Inspector (CWI).
– National Institute for Certification in Engineering Technologies (NICET): NICET provides certifications focused on engineering technology, including welding inspection.
– Other industry certifications: Organizations like the International Institute of Welding (IIW) also offer internationally recognized certifications.

Training programs:
– Community colleges often provide welding programs accredited by AWS. These programs can offer foundational training and lead to certifications.
– Apprenticeships: Many aspiring welders benefit from hands-on training through union or employer-sponsored apprenticeship programs. The U.S. Department of Labor notes that these programs can lead to a journeyman certification, recognized nationally.

Industry demands: Welding certifications can vary by industry. The U.S. Bureau of Labor Statistics indicates that sectors like construction and manufacturing often look for specific AWS certifications in job postings. Therefore, beginners should research the local market to understand preferred qualifications.

Continuing education: Certification is not a one-time event. Welders may need to renew their certifications through continuing education or re-testing. Staying updated on industry standards is vital for career advancement.

In summary, beginner welders should clarify their career objectives, research certification types and training options, and stay aware of industry trends to make informed decisions regarding their certification path.

What Skills Do Beginner Welders Develop at Entry-Level Certifications?

Beginner welders develop several key skills at entry-level certifications. These skills include:

  1. Safety Procedures
  2. Welding Techniques
  3. Equipment Operation
  4. Reading Blueprints
  5. Quality Control
  6. Metal Preparation
  7. Basic Mathematics
  8. Problem-Solving

These foundational skills serve as the building blocks for a successful career in welding. They provide a solid basis for more advanced techniques and specialized applications.

  1. Safety Procedures: Beginner welders learn essential safety procedures to protect themselves and others. Understanding personal protective equipment (PPE) is crucial. This includes gloves, helmets, and protective clothing. According to OSHA, proper safety training reduces workplace incidents significantly.

  2. Welding Techniques: Beginner welders are introduced to various welding techniques, such as MIG (Metal Inert Gas), TIG (Tungsten Inert Gas), and Stick welding. Each technique has its applications and requires different skills. For example, MIG welding is popular in automotive applications due to its speed and versatility (Welding Journal, 2019).

  3. Equipment Operation: Understanding how to operate welding equipment properly is a critical skill. Beginners get hands-on experience with welding machines, torches, and safety gear. This practical knowledge helps prevent equipment malfunctions and accidents.

  4. Reading Blueprints: Beginner welders learn to read and interpret blueprints and technical drawings. This skill is vital for understanding project specifications and requirements. The ability to visualize how components fit together enhances the quality of the work produced.

  5. Quality Control: The ability to assess the quality of welds is part of the skill set for beginner welders. They learn to identify acceptable weld characteristics and how to improve their techniques. This focus on quality ensures that welds meet industry standards and specifications.

  6. Metal Preparation: Preparing metal surfaces for welding is another acquiring skill. This includes cleaning, grinding, and fitting pieces together. Proper preparation is essential for achieving strong, durable welds.

  7. Basic Mathematics: Beginner welders utilize basic mathematics for measurements and calculations. Skills in geometry help welders in cutting materials accurately and ensuring proper joint dimensions. This improves overall efficiency and reduces waste.

  8. Problem-Solving: As they begin to work on diverse projects, beginner welders develop problem-solving skills. They learn to troubleshoot issues related to welding processes and materials. This adaptability is essential in the welding industry.

How Are Welding Quality and Safety Enhanced Through Certification Levels?

Welding quality and safety improve through certification levels by establishing standardized training and assessment criteria. Certification levels define skill benchmarks for welders. These benchmarks ensure that welders possess the necessary knowledge and competencies. Higher certification levels require more in-depth training and testing. This training often includes hands-on practice in various welding techniques and safety protocols.

The certification process usually involves written exams and practical evaluations. These assess not only technical skills but also adherence to safety guidelines. As welders advance through certification levels, they learn to identify potential issues and implement solutions effectively.

Certification ensures that welders are qualified to work on complex projects. It minimizes the risk of defects in welds, leading to higher quality outcomes. Moreover, certified welders follow established safety practices. This reduces the likelihood of accidents in the workplace. Companies benefit from employing certified welders as it enhances their reputation and compliance with industry regulations.

In summary, certification levels enhance welding quality and safety by providing structured training, verifying skills, and promoting adherence to safety standards.
